Massive Blaze Engulfs Volume Club Building
Massive flames tore through the Volume Club karaoke bar in Hanoi on Monday, reducing the building to ruins and leaving one person dead.

Footage shows police officers securing the area as firefighters worked to contain the blaze, which sent plumes of thick smoke over the area. Locals and journalists gathered behind barricades nearby to watch the rescue operations.
Witnesses Describe Rapid Spread of Fire
“Around 10:00 am, residents started seeing smoke coming from cracks in the doors, so they called the fire department, and within about five minutes, three fire trucks arrived,” said witness Thanh Hoang.

“The fire inside seemed quite complicated. More fire trucks arrived later, but the fire was already out of control. The fire was finally extinguished completely around 4:00 pm this afternoon, and rescue efforts are still ongoing,” he continued.
Authorities Investigate Cause of Hanoi Blaze
The fire gutted the building on Phu My Street, leaving behind charred debris and collapsed floors. Preliminary investigations suggest the blaze may have been sparked by an electrical short circuit, according to local media.

Authorities sealed off the area, searched for possible victims and brought the fire largely under control by noon. Meanwhile, the exact cause remains under investigation.
